Recap: Pair of Rams finish top-20 at MountainView Collegiate

TUCSON, Ariz. -
Freshman Ellen Secor and sophomore Katrina Prendergast earned top-20 performances on Sunday, placing in 14th and 16th place, respectively, at the MountainView Collegiate Invitational. As a team, Colorado State played its best golf of the weekend on Sunday, shooting a 12-over 300 during Round 3. The Rams improved each round, finishing at 52-over 916 and in 12th place.

This marks the third time this season that at least two Rams have placed in the top 20 of a tournament, with each one featuring Prendergast and Secor. On Sunday, Secor carded an even-par 72 during the final round, one of 20 golfers in the field to shoot par or better. For the weekend, she recorded a 3-over 219, including a 1-under 71 during the opening round.

Prendergast was one stroke behind Secor, carding a 1-over 73 on the day and 4-over 220 for the weekend. She shot 73 twice and 74 once during the three-round tournament. She has finished in the top 20 for all three tournaments this spring.

Senior Brianna Becker performed well on Sunday, shooting a 4-over 76 and finishing the weekend at 21-over 237. Senior Elisabeth Rau was a couple spots behind Becker, carding a 24-over 240. Junior Sarah Archuleta had her best round of the weekend on Sunday, finishing at 33-over 249. Freshman Jessica Sloot competed as an individual, posting a 24-over 240, including a 5-over 77 during Round 3.

Arizona won the tournament by 21 strokes, carding a 14-under 850. New Mexico State placed second (7-over 871), followed by Houston (10-over 874), UNLV and Oklahoma (15-over 879), Missouri and Kansas State (24-over 888), Ole Miss (28-over 892), Central Arkansas (31-over 895), Middle Tennessee State (37-over 901), North Texas (43-over 907), CSU (52-over 916) and Redlands Community College (108-over 972).

After three tournaments in 14 days to begin the spring season, the Rams will finally get some much-needed rest. CSU will next compete in the Bryan National, in Browns Summit, N.C., March 31-April 2.
